Artificial Intelligence (AI) coding assistants have reached a new peak in 2025. From real-time code generation to refactoring entire repositories, the best AI models for coding are transforming how software is built, reviewed, and maintained. If you’re a developer, team lead, or even a startup CTO, choosing the right AI assistant could dramatically boost productivity and code quality.
In this guide, we’ll explore the best AI model for coding in 2025, breaking down each contender’s strengths, weaknesses, and ideal use cases. We’ll look at advanced features like multi-language support, security-focused development, and how AI integrates with your IDE in real time. Think of it like sitting down for coffee with a friend who’s tried every tool on the market—you’ll walk away with clarity and confidence.
Whether you’re maintaining legacy code, deploying modern microservices, or building cross-platform apps, this article will help you choose the right AI tool. Let’s dive into the top AI coding models of 2025 and see which one best fits your needs.
1. Overview: Why AI Coding Tools Matter in 2025
AI has moved from novelty to necessity in software development. In 2025, the best AI coding tools are no longer just autocomplete suggestions—they refactor codebases, detect vulnerabilities, and generate unit tests. Developers now expect AI assistants that understand project structure, offer context-aware insights, and adapt to coding patterns.
This evolution matters because speed, security, and correctness are more critical than ever. Whether you’re scaling a SaaS business or modernizing enterprise systems, AI coding models help reduce technical debt, ship features faster, and safeguard compliance—all while learning your workflow over time.
2. Claude 3.7 Sonnet: Precision for Complex Codebases
Claude 3.7 Sonnet is one of the most advanced AI models for code reasoning in 2025. What sets it apart is its dual-mode architecture—offering both fast pattern recognition and deep analytical reasoning. This means you can toggle between quick suggestions or ask Claude for multi-step logic generation.
It’s especially powerful in legacy environments. For instance, when a major insurance firm used Claude 3.7 to refactor COBOL code, the model achieved 85% functional parity with significantly fewer manual interventions. Developers use it for system migrations, debugging edge-case logic, and even modeling API integrations across unfamiliar stacks.
3. Gemini 2.5 Pro: The Refactoring Powerhouse
Google’s Gemini 2.5 Pro leads the pack in large-scale codebase understanding. Thanks to its 1 million token context window, it can digest entire repositories including commit histories, architectural patterns, and cross-file dependencies. It recently refactored a React project with over 750,000 lines of code, reusing 92% of components accurately.
If you’re working on projects with complex dependencies—think monorepos or microservices—Gemini 2.5 Pro is like having an AI architect on your team. It shines in scenario-based optimizations such as caching strategies or memory-efficient data structures across the stack.
4. Codestral by Mistral: Polyglot Coding Master
In a world of diverse tech stacks, Codestral 22B is the multilingual champion. With support for over 80 programming languages and a 32K token context window, it’s perfect for teams juggling Python, TypeScript, Kotlin, and even less common languages like Erlang or Rust.
What makes Codestral special is its framework-awareness. It doesn’t just write code—it understands idioms and libraries native to each language. A fintech startup used it to develop GraphQL resolvers that achieved 98% type coverage across three services in different languages. If you’re in a polyglot environment, Codestral is a strong pick.
5. DeepSeek-Coder-33B: Code Completion and Testing Genius
This model may not grab headlines like the others, but DeepSeek-Coder-33B delivers where it counts—code completion accuracy. With a Pass@1 rating of 78.65% across 17 languages on the HumanEval benchmark, it’s built for speed and correctness in real-time coding tasks.
It’s especially good at writing robust unit and integration tests. Developers using DeepSeek report a 40% reduction in manual test writing time. If you’re looking for a well-rounded, fast AI partner for daily development sprints, DeepSeek-Coder-33B is worth serious consideration.
6. Tabnine Protected 2: Security and Compliance First
Security-conscious teams will appreciate Tabnine Protected 2. It focuses on license-safe code generation and compliance, spotting 93% of common vulnerabilities and achieving 87% accuracy in license conflict detection. This is critical for teams operating under strict legal or industry constraints.
One legal tech firm reported a 50% reduction in code review cycles after adopting Tabnine. Its clean-room training approach gives peace of mind in sectors like healthcare, finance, and government contracting.
7. Windsurf IDE: Seamless AI-First Coding Experience
Windsurf isn’t just another plugin—it’s a full AI-first IDE. Built on Llama 3.1 405B, it offers features like Supercomplete for smart autocompletion and Cascade for iterative problem-solving. Its real-time syncing with project files allows it to understand your entire workspace contextually.
Developers report a 40% increase in feature delivery speed thanks to Windsurf’s Flow technology. It’s especially useful in collaborative or fast-paced dev environments like startups or product teams shipping weekly.
8. Claude Code (Terminal Agent): Automation for DevOps Tasks
Claude Code introduces a terminal-native AI agent that automates multi-step tasks like migrations or testing. For example, you can instruct it to migrate an Express.js API to Fastify with TypeScript, and it will generate the plugins, adjust middleware, and create test suites autonomously.
This model is ideal for DevOps engineers and backend developers handling routine but complex infrastructure tasks. It’s like having a junior engineer that never sleeps.
9. How These Models Stack Up: Performance Benchmarks
Let’s talk numbers. On the HumanEval benchmark, Codestral tops the list with 81.1% Pass@1, followed closely by DeepSeek and Claude 3.7 Sonnet. Gemini 2.5 Pro lags slightly at 68.6%, but its strength lies in architectural understanding, not single-snippet generation.
The takeaway? Match the model to your workflow. If you’re writing a lot of algorithmic code, DeepSeek or Codestral might be best. For large-scale systems, Gemini or Claude 3.7 will serve you better.
10. Real-World Success Stories
A SaaS team refactored their entire Node.js backend with Gemini 2.5 Pro in under two weeks. A healthcare provider used Claude 3.7 Sonnet to build a HIPAA-compliant audit logging system in record time. And a gaming studio relied on Codestral to implement cross-platform UIs in Unity and Unreal with seamless TypeScript integration.
These tools aren’t theoretical—they’re delivering real value today.
11. Limitations and Caveats
Despite the progress, no model is perfect. Some still hallucinate code, especially in edge cases. Others struggle with long-term memory across sessions. Security-wise, 18% of generated code might contain license issues or risky snippets unless explicitly filtered.
This is why tools like Tabnine or Claude with SWE-bench scores above 60% are important for mission-critical systems. Always validate AI output and pair it with human oversight where needed.
12. What to Look For When Choosing an AI Model
Your ideal AI model depends on context. Are you building MVPs fast? Go with DeepSeek or Windsurf. Refactoring a legacy stack? Claude or Gemini are your best bet. Need legal compliance? Tabnine wins. Polyglot app? Codestral is king.
Consider the following: programming language support, context window size, IDE integration, test generation, and license safety. Align your selection with your team’s goals, not just benchmarks.
13. The Future of AI Coding in 2026 and Beyond
Exciting trends are emerging: agentic development environments, natural language-to-code pipelines, and self-healing codebases. Tools like Google’s Code AutoPatch and OpenAI’s Codex-NLC are already experimenting with full-featured app generation from high-level specs.
Expect more real-time collaboration, autonomous debugging, and even AI pair programming. The future is not just about writing code—it’s about co-creating software with intelligent agents.
14. Final Thoughts: Strategy Over Hype
Choosing the best AI model for coding in 2025 isn’t about jumping on the latest trend. It’s about aligning capabilities with your dev workflow, security needs, and team composition. The smartest teams in 2025 are the ones treating AI as a teammate, not just a tool.
15. How Two-Mation Can Help
At Two-Mation, we help businesses integrate AI models like Claude, Gemini, and DeepSeek into real-world development pipelines. Whether you’re automating tests, modernizing your architecture, or building secure code from scratch, our team can help you implement the right AI solution that fits your tech stack and goals.
Need help choosing or deploying the best AI coding model for your team? Let’s talk.
FAQs
1. What is the best AI model for coding in 2025?
That depends on your use case. For complex reasoning, Claude 3.7 Sonnet is excellent. For large-scale refactoring, Gemini 2.5 Pro leads. Codestral is best for multilingual environments, and Tabnine offers top-tier license safety.
2. Are AI coding tools safe for production use?
Yes, but with human oversight. Models like Tabnine and Claude offer security features to reduce vulnerabilities, but always review AI-generated code before deployment.
3. Can AI coding models understand my entire project?
Yes, especially models like Gemini 2.5 Pro with their 1 million token context window. They can analyze full repositories, track dependencies, and even refactor across files intelligently.
4. Which AI coding model is best for startups?
Startups often benefit from DeepSeek-Coder-33B or Windsurf for speed and budget. These models help iterate quickly, generate reliable boilerplate, and test efficiently.
5. Does Two-Mation offer integration services for AI coding models?
Absolutely. Two-Mation helps organizations integrate AI development tools into their stack, ensuring seamless deployment, training, and ongoing optimization tailored to your workflow.
We’d Love Your Feedback
Which AI coding model are you most excited about in 2025? Did one of these tools surprise you? Share this article with your developer network and let us know your thoughts on how AI is changing your workflow. Your input helps us cover what matters most to developers like you.